Synopsis

Twist and testimony from the home front during the Great War, told through witty letters and vivid scenes.

This novel friendship, memory, and courage set the stage with Aunt Sarah and her colorful circle as they navigate love, loss, and national upheaval.

In a series of personal letters and diary-like passages, the book follows families and servants whose lives are touched by war. Sharp humor blends with heartfelt moments, painting a portrait of English society under stress and hope alike. The alternating voices reveal how ordinary people respond when duty, affection, and a changing world collide.
